Beyond the CEO: Exploring Executive Board Roles

Executive boards encompass a multitude of roles, each playing a critical part in organizational governance:

  • Chairman/Chairwoman: Provides leadership and direction to the board, ensuring effective boardroom operations.
  • Chief Executive Officer (CEO): The organization’s top executive, responsible for strategic vision, overall performance, and board communication.
  • Chief Financial Officer (CFO): Oversees all financial operations, ensuring accurate reporting and managing financial risks.
  • Chief Operating Officer (COO): Drives day-to-day operations, implementing strategic plans and ensuring operational efficiency.
  • Non-Executive Directors: Independent board members who offer diverse perspectives, provide objective oversight, and hold management accountable.

Developing the Skills Needed for Executive Board Opportunities

Success on the executive board demands a specific skillset:

  • Strategic Thinking: Ability to envision the organization’s future, analyze trends, and formulate strategic plans for long-term growth.
  • Financial Acumen: Understanding of financial statements, risk analysis, and making sound financial decisions.
  • Leadership & Communication Skills: Inspiring and motivating others, leading board discussions effectively, and communicating clearly with stakeholders.
  • Industry Expertise: Deep knowledge of the specific industry, its challenges, and competitive landscape.
  • Strong Governance Knowledge: Understanding best practices for corporate governance ensures ethical and compliant boardroom operations.
